Guiding Requirements for the Ongoing Scheme Standardization Process

摘要
The Scheme standardization process has produced several Scheme revisions, the most recent one being RRS. The RRS standardization process is underway with an amended charter. The new charter has introduced two language levels, Small Scheme and Large Scheme, succinctly described as “lightweight” and “heavyweight”, respectively. We analyze this new charter and propose some modifications to it that we believe would help the standardization of Scheme, and in particular steer it towards greater use by the software developer community. We suggest that the Steering Committee establish guiding requirements for the two Scheme levels. We discuss some examples of concrete guiding requirements to include in the standardization process for maintenance and debugging. We also discuss the need for an additional general principle for Small Scheme and suggest that, besides the general principle of a small language specification, the notion of efficiency of execution is also at the core of Small Scheme.
